Learning ERA
• ERA stands for:
• It is a way of telling how productive a pitcher is during the course of a season, and his career.
Earned Run Average
Learning ERA
• Earned Run: “Every time a run scores on a hit, sacrifice, sacrifice fly, wild pitch, bunt, base on balls, stolen base, fielder's choice, put-out, or balk a pitcher will be charged an earned run.”
Learning ERA
• Sacrifice Fly: ”Occurs when a batter’s caught fly ball ends in a runner tagging up and
advancing to the next base”
Learning ERA
• Wild Pitch: “Any pitch that bounces on the ground and allows the runners to advance to the next base.”
Learning ERA
• Base on Balls: “An award of first base o a batter receiving four balls pitched outside of the strike zone.”
• Base on balls and the term “walk” mean the same thing.
Learning ERA
• Stolen Base: “The act of a runner gaining a base without the help of a hit, an error, or a walk. Occurs when the pitched ball is on its way to the batter.”
Learning ERA
• Fielder’s Choice: When a fielder elects to throw the ball to a point other than first base to record a put-out
Learning ERA
• Balk: An illegal maneuver by the pitcher when there is a runner or runners on the base. The runners automatically proceed to the next base when balk is called.
Learning ERA
• Unearned Run: A run scored as the result of defensive errors

Practicing ERA
Equation for finding ERA:# of EARNED runs # of innings pitched
9
• You multiply by 9 because an ERA is the average number of earned runs a pitcher gives up per full game. A regular baseball game consists of 9 innings.
